91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

netframework的垃圾回收機制

小樊
83
2024-06-19 14:27:08
欄目: 編程語言

.NET Framework是一種由微軟開發的應用程序框架,它提供了一種管理內存和資源的機制,其中包括垃圾回收機制。垃圾回收機制是.NET Framework中的一項重要功能,它負責自動管理內存分配和釋放,以減少內存泄漏和提高系統性能。

.NET Framework的垃圾回收機制是基于代際垃圾回收的原理。在.NET Framework中,內存被分為三代:第0代、第1代和第2代。垃圾回收器會定期檢查這些代的內存對象,并清理不再使用的對象以釋放內存空間。

垃圾回收器通過掃描應用程序的堆棧和靜態對象來確定哪些對象是活動的,哪些是垃圾對象。一旦確定了垃圾對象,垃圾回收器就會將它們標記為可回收的,并在適當的時機進行垃圾回收操作,將這些對象所占用的內存空間釋放出來。

總的來說,.NET Framework的垃圾回收機制可以幫助開發人員簡化內存管理的工作,減少內存泄漏的風險,提高系統的性能和穩定性。在大多數情況下,開發人員不需要手動管理內存,因為垃圾回收機制會自動處理這些工作。

0
连南| 长沙市| 闽清县| 宜君县| 灵丘县| 兰州市| 抚松县| 镇远县| 永泰县| 屯门区| 平度市| 于田县| 雅江县| 山西省| 丹棱县| 保定市| 婺源县| 依兰县| 九江市| 万山特区| 霸州市| 淮北市| 富川| 芒康县| 辰溪县| 武鸣县| 安阳县| 临沂市| 安溪县| 泾源县| 葵青区| 上思县| 兴宁市| 昌图县| 卓尼县| 甘谷县| 竹溪县| 青河县| 上林县| 木里| 公主岭市|